September 1994, TT Superbike Supercup, Brands Hatch
A dull, overcast day at Brands greeted the final two races in the 1994 British TT Superbike championship. The front row for the first heat comprised Kiwi Andrew Stroud (#19) on a Loctite Yamaha, Matt Llewellyn (Ducati, #6), championship leader Ian Simpson (Duckhams Norton, #25), Loctite Yamaha-mounted Jim Moodie (#2) and pole position man Phil Borley (#30) on a Duckhams Norton. Steve Hislop on the Castrol Honda RC45 (#3) is making a decent start from the second row.
